D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ES

Centers for Disease Control and Prevention

 
Disease, Disability, and Injury Prevention and Control Special 
Emphasis Panel (SEP): Participatory Research on Community Interventions 
to Increase the Utilization of Effective Cancer Preventive and 
Treatment Services, Program Announcement Number 04087

    In accordance with Section 10(a)(2) of the Federal Advisory 
Committee Act (Pub. L. 92-463), the Centers for Disease Control and 
Prevention (CDC) announces the following meeting:

    Name: Disease, Disability, and Injury Prevention and Control 
Special Emphasis Panel (SEP): Participatory Research on Community 
Interventions to Increase the Utilization of Effective Cancer 
Preventive and Treatment Services, Program Announcement Number 
04087.
    Times and Dates: 8:30 a.m.-9 a.m., June 17, 2004 (Open); 9 a.m.-
5 p.m., June 17, 2004 (Closed).
    Place: Sheraton Midtown Atlanta Hotel at Colony Square, 188 14th 
Street at Peachtree, Atlanta, GA 30361, Telephone 404.892.6000.
    Status: Portions of the meeting will be closed to the public in 
accordance with provisions set forth in Section 552b(c) (4) and (6), 
Title 5 U.S.C., and the Determination of the Director, Management 
Analysis and Services Office, CDC, pursuant to Public Law 92-463.
    Matters To Be Discussed: The meeting will include the review, 
discussion, and evaluation of applications received in response to 
Participatory Research on Community Interventions to Increase the 
Utilization of Effective Cancer Preventive and Treatment Services, 
Program Announcement Number 04087.
